TYPE 1 17-BETA HYDROXYSTEROID DEHYDROGENASE EM1745 COMPLEX

Template:ABSTRACT PUBMED 12223444

About this Structure

1I5R is a 1 chain structure of sequence from Homo sapiens. Full crystallographic information is available from OCA.

Reference

  • Qiu W, Campbell RL, Gangloff A, Dupuis P, Boivin RP, Tremblay MR, Poirier D, Lin SX. A concerted, rational design of type 1 17beta-hydroxysteroid dehydrogenase inhibitors: estradiol-adenosine hybrids with high affinity. FASEB J. 2002 Nov;16(13):1829-31. Epub 2002 Sep 5. PMID:12223444 doi:10.1096/fj.02-0026fje
